数据库备份还原

来源:互联网 发布:linux系统安装教程 编辑:程序博客网 时间:2024/06/06 08:57

---备份之前测试
select *from mydb..tb
/*
id          name
----------- ----------
1           张三
2           李四
3           王五
*/
---------备份---------
backup database mydb
to disk='d:db/mydb.bak'
----创建新数据库------
create database mydb2
------开始还原--------
--
----还原操作不要放到你备份的哪个数据库中执行---
--
----要不会提示,该数据库正在运行---------------
restore database mydb2/*mydb2 为一个新数据库 必须是已经创建好的 */
from disk='d:/db/mydb.bak'/* mydb的备份路径*/
with
move
'mydb' to 'D:/db/mydb.mdf',/*移动数据库文件,移出默认的数据库存放文件夹就行了*/
move
'mydb_log' to 'D:/db/mydb_log.ldf',/*移动日志文件*/
replace
------------------测试还原结果---------------------
select * from mydb2..tb
/*
id          name
----------- ----------
1           张三
2           李四
3           王五
*/
-----------------------------OK-----------------------

原创粉丝点击